Just as the public is trying to digest the shocking details revealed in the hit Netflix documentary about Diddy, rapper 50 Cent (real name Curtis Jackson) has issued a chilling warning: What you’ve seen is only the tip of the iceberg.
The music and film mogul recently disclosed that he is still holding onto hours of unreleased footage related to Sean “Diddy” Combs’ chaotic empire. And he is seriously considering posting it entirely free on YouTube, a move that could once again shake the entertainment industry to its core.
The Footage Netflix Left Behind
50 Cent’s highly anticipated Netflix documentary garnered millions of views and significantly contributed to the ongoing investigation into Diddy. However, in a recent interview, Jackson confirmed that not all the evidence he collected made it into Netflix’s final cut.
“I have a lot of stuff. A lot of stuff we couldn’t put in the film for various reasons,” 50 Cent stated. “You have to understand, there are time limits, legal issues, and even things that the audience is not ready to see yet.”
The fact that 50 Cent, known for his protracted public feud with Diddy, still possesses unreleased material has ignited a frenzy of speculation. The online community is wondering: if the aired segments were shocking enough, how truly explosive is the footage being held back?
The YouTube Strategy: A Public Finishing Blow

Most notably is 50 Cent’s intention regarding the release platform: YouTube. Instead of selling it to other streaming services, he wants to turn it into a “public premiere,” entirely free for everyone around the world to access.
“I’m considering putting it up on YouTube myself,” Jackson confirmed. “If people want to see all of it, I might just let them see all of it. I don’t need anyone’s approval.”
This could be a strategically ruthless and effective move. By using YouTube, 50 Cent entirely bypasses the complex censorship and legal hurdles of major studios. This ensures that the footage, no matter how sensitive, will be delivered to the public without edits or cuts.
